Re: [PATCH 3/4] KVM/X86: Enable Intel MPX for guest

2013-11-29 Thread Paolo Bonzini
 diff --git a/arch/x86/kvm/cpuid.c b/arch/x86/kvm/cpuid.c
 index a8ce117..e30d4ce 100644
 --- a/arch/x86/kvm/cpuid.c
 +++ b/arch/x86/kvm/cpuid.c
 @@ -75,7 +75,7 @@ void kvm_update_cpuid(struct kvm_vcpu *vcpu)
   (best-eax | ((u64)best-edx  32)) 
   host_xcr0  KVM_SUPPORTED_XCR0;
   vcpu-arch.guest_xstate_size = best-ebx =
 - xstate_required_size(vcpu-arch.guest_supported_xcr0);
 + xstate_required_size(vcpu-arch.xcr0);
   }
  
   kvm_pmu_cpuid_update(vcpu);
 ...
   kvm_put_guest_xcr0(vcpu);
   vcpu-arch.xcr0 = xcr0;
 +
 + if ((xcr0 ^ old_xcr0)  XSTATE_EXTEND_MASK)
 + kvm_update_cpuid(vcpu);
 +
   return 0;
  }

These hunks should be part of the previous patch.

 @@ -5960,6 +5967,9 @@ static int vcpu_enter_guest(struct kvm_vcpu *vcpu)
   preempt_disable();
  
   kvm_x86_ops-prepare_guest_switch(vcpu);
 + if (kvm_read_cr4_bits(vcpu, X86_CR4_OSXSAVE) 

Shouldn't be necessary, setting xcr0 fails unless OSXSAVE=1.

 + (vcpu-arch.xcr0  (u64)(XSTATE_BNDREGS | XSTATE_BNDCSR)))
 + kvm_x86_ops-fpu_activate(vcpu);

Can you explain this?

   if (vcpu-fpu_active)
   kvm_load_guest_fpu(vcpu);
   kvm_load_guest_xcr0(vcpu);
 diff --git a/arch/x86/kvm/x86.h b/arch/x86/kvm/x86.h
 index 587fb9e..985e40e 100644
 --- a/arch/x86/kvm/x86.h
 +++ b/arch/x86/kvm/x86.h
 @@ -122,7 +122,8 @@ int kvm_write_guest_virt_system(struct x86_emulate_ctxt 
 *ctxt,
   gva_t addr, void *val, unsigned int bytes,
   struct x86_exception *exception);
  
 -#define KVM_SUPPORTED_XCR0   (XSTATE_FP | XSTATE_SSE | XSTATE_YMM)
 +#define KVM_SUPPORTED_XCR0   (XSTATE_FP | XSTATE_SSE | XSTATE_YMM \
 + | XSTATE_BNDREGS | XSTATE_BNDCSR)
  extern u64 host_xcr0;
  
  extern struct static_key kvm_no_apic_vcpu;
 

Otherwise looks straightforward.
